This playbook explains how to execute Shadow Fiend carry effectively in Patch 7.40c within structured Rivals matches. Shadow Fiend wins through lane dominance, fast farming acceleration and early-mid game pressure. Your objective is to snowball between 12 and 35 minutes and end the game before scaling cores overtake you.
Step 1: Dominate the Lane Through Soul Control
Objective: Build Feast of Souls stacks consistently.

Lane Rules
- •Prioritise last hits and denies. Both grant soul stacks.
- •Do not overtrade early without souls built.
- •Use Shadowraze to secure ranged creeps when necessary.
- •Control creep equilibrium near your tower.
If you are missing multiple denies, you are weakening your scaling. Correct immediately.
Feast of Souls scaling depends on disciplined lane mechanics.
Step 2: Skill and Early Farm Acceleration
Skill priority
- 1.Max Shadowraze first.
- 2.Level Feast of Souls alongside it.
- 3.Take Presence of the Dark Lord after core damage is online.
- 4.Ultimate at 6 / 12 / 18.
Level 7: Max Shadowraze enables rapid wave and jungle clear.
Checklist
- •Stack camps (or request stacks).
- •Triple Raze stacked camps efficiently.
- •Maintain high soul count at all times.
If your soul stacks drop unnecessarily, your damage drops sharply.

Step 4: Mid-Game Spike (Primary Win Window)
Core Progression
Fighting Core





This is your strongest stage of the game.
Checklist
- •Pressure towers after winning fights.
- •Use Presence aura to amplify team damage.
- •Stay behind frontline.
- •Pop BKB before committing if disables are ready.
If you win a fight between 15–30 minutes, immediately convert into tower or Roshan pressure.

Step 6: Requiem Usage
Requiem is not only for flashy plays.
Use it
- •After BKB activation.
- •In choke points.
- •When enemies are controlled by teammates.
Avoid
- •Channeling in open vision without protection.
- •Using it as first contact without setup.
Requiem is strongest when layered with team stuns.
Matchup Awareness
Strong Versus
- •Low-armor heroes.
- •Ranged cores you can outfarm and outburst.
- •Heroes vulnerable to armour reduction aura.
Struggles Versus
- •Disruptor — zone control and cancellation.
- •Storm Spirit — gap-close and burst.
- •Phantom Assassin — burst and evasion pressure.
If facing jump-heavy drafts, prioritise positioning and defensive items earlier.

If You're Losing, Do This
- 1.Stop joining scattered fights.
- 2.Stack and clear jungle efficiently.
- 3.Farm side lanes safely with vision.
- 4.Prioritise BKB before more damage.
- 5.Look for pickoffs with team setup.
Shadow Fiend can recover if he maintains soul stacks and avoids repeated deaths.
